Top Parks in Missouri City, TX
Richmond Avenue Park
Richmond Avenue Park is one of the most popular parks in Missouri City, offering a wide range of amenities. The park features a children's playground, basketball courts, and a scenic walking trail that winds through lush greenery.
For those looking to stay active, the park also has a fitness trail equipped with exercise stations. Families can enjoy picnics in the designated areas, complete with tables and grills. Richmond Avenue Park is a perfect spot for a day out with loved ones.
Sienna Plantation Community Park
Sienna Plantation Community Park is a sprawling 100-acre park that offers something for everyone. The park features a large lake where visitors can enjoy fishing and paddle boating. Nature enthusiasts will appreciate the park's diverse wildlife and beautiful landscaping.

The park also boasts multiple sports fields, a disc golf course, and a dog park. With its extensive amenities and serene atmosphere, Sienna Plantation Community Park is a must-visit destination in Missouri City.

Parks for Nature Lovers
For those who appreciate the beauty of nature, Missouri City has several parks that offer a peaceful retreat. These parks are designed to preserve the natural environment while providing access to outdoor activities.
Atwater Prairies Park is a prime example, with its native prairie grasslands and diverse wildlife. Visitors can explore the park's nature trails and learn about the local flora and fauna through interpretive signage.
Sienna Plantation Community Park also offers a nature trail that winds through wooded areas and along the park's lake. These parks provide a perfect setting for birdwatching, photography, and quiet reflection.

Historical Parks in Missouri City
Missouri City's parks not only offer recreational opportunities but also serve as gateways to the city's rich history. Atwater Prairies Park, for example, preserves a piece of Texas history with its native prairie grasslands and historical markers.
Visitors can learn about the area's agricultural heritage and the efforts to restore and maintain the prairie ecosystem. These historical parks provide a unique blend of education and recreation, making them valuable resources for residents and visitors alike.
Dog-Friendly Parks
Dog owners in Missouri City have several options for parks where their furry friends can play and socialize. Sienna Plantation Community Park features a dedicated dog park with separate areas for large and small dogs.
The dog park is equipped with shade structures, water fountains, and agility equipment. Visitors can enjoy watching their dogs play while taking in the park's beautiful surroundings.
Other parks, such as Otis Brown Park, also allow dogs on leash, providing additional opportunities for pet-friendly outings.
